Which detection system delays notification to allow verification before alerting responders?

Explanation:
Verification in detection systems is about delaying notification to allow confirmation before alerting responders. This design introduces a brief pause after an initial detection so the system—or an operator—can verify that a real emergency is occurring, not a false alarm caused by dust, steam, or a temporary nuisance. By requiring a second check or human validation before dispatching units, it reduces unnecessary alarms and preserves response resources. If the system triggered alarms immediately, that would be an alarm-type setup. If it skipped verification and alerted directly, it would be a direct system. A simple delayed approach without built-in verification could delay alerts for other reasons, but the defining feature here is the intentional verification step before notification.
